Why Web Designers Look for White Label SEO Link Building
Web designers are often the first professional a business hires. Because of that, clients naturally expect guidance beyond design. SEO and link building become part of the conversation whether you want them to or not.
Many designers do not want to turn SEO away. Doing so can feel like leaving value on the table or abandoning the client after launch. At the same time, delivering SEO in-house is rarely realistic.
White label SEO link building appears to solve this problem. You stay client-facing, while the execution happens behind the scenes.
That appeal is understandable. Still, not all white label arrangements are created equal.
The Hidden Risks of White Label SEO
White label SEO often looks simple on the surface. In reality, it introduces shared responsibility without shared control.
When you put your name on SEO work you do not manage directly, your reputation is tied to every outcome. If links are low quality, inconsistent, or risky, the client does not blame the provider. They blame you.
Over time, this creates stress.
Designers find themselves explaining SEO decisions they did not make. They absorb frustration for delays they cannot fix. In some cases, they lose clients because of work that happened outside their visibility.
This is why many designers become cautious about white label SEO after trying it once.
Why White Label Link Building Is the Most Sensitive Part
Among all SEO activities, link building carries the highest risk.
Poor link building does not just fail to deliver results. It can actively harm a website. Penalties, ranking drops, and long recovery timelines are real concerns.
For web designers, this is especially dangerous. Clients may forgive slow results, but they rarely forgive damage. When link building goes wrong, trust is difficult to rebuild.
That is why white label SEO link building must be handled with more care than any other outsourced SEO task.
